Ques. Is RHCT still a valid certification, or has it been replaced?
Ans. The RHCT (Red Hat Certified Technician) designation has been officially retired by Red Hat Inc. and replaced by the RHCSA (Red Hat Certified System Administrator) certification. The training program at DBS Global University under the Red Hat Linux banner prepares students for RHCSA-level competencies, which is the current entry-level Red Hat certification and is widely recognized by employers globally.

Ques. What is the difference between the DBS Global University Red Hat Linux certificate and the official RHCSA certification from Red Hat?
Ans. The DBS Global University certificate is issued by the university upon completion of the 6-month training program. The RHCSA (Red Hat Certified System Administrator) is an official, globally recognized certification issued by Red Hat Inc. after passing a performance-based exam. The university training prepares you for the RHCSA exam, but the two credentials are separate. Students who wish to earn the official RHCSA must appear for the Red Hat exam separately.
Ques. What career roles can I pursue after completing this Red Hat Linux program?
Ans. After completing this program, students can pursue roles such as Linux System Administrator, IT Infrastructure Engineer, DevOps Engineer, Cloud Engineer, Network Administrator, and Security Analyst. Red Hat-certified professionals are in high demand at IT companies, cloud service providers (AWS, Azure, Google Cloud), banks, and government organizations.
